Eva’s home is located at 72° 30’ E longitude. Sophia lives at 72° 30’ W longitude. Which student lives closer to the Prime Merid
anyanavicka [17]

Answer:

Correct answer is that they are the same distance from the prime meridian.

Explanation:

The answer above is correct because prime meridian longitude is defined as 0 degrees. Therefore, it doesn't matter if we go towards the east or the west, if the numbers are the same it means that they are at the same distance from the prime meridian.

The passage below is from the U.S. Supreme Court decision In re Gault (1967). From the inception of the juvenile court system, w
Ann [662]

Answer:

B. States must provide minors accused of crimes with most of the same "due process" rights given to adults.

Explanation:

The passage below is from the U.S. Supreme Court decision In re Gault (1967). From the inception of the juvenile court system, wide differences have been tolerated... between the procedural rights accorded to adults and those of juveniles. In practically all jurisdictions, there are rights granted to adults, which are withheld from juveniles.. [H]istory has again demonstrated that unbridled discretion, however benevolently motivated, is frequently a poor substitute for principle and procedure... Which conclusion did the Court draw from this reasoning? In re Gault was a case where parents believed their child was denied due process. The court ruled that states must reform their procedures of juvenile justice in order words,States must provide minors accused of crimes with most of the same "due process" rights given to adults.
